Saturday, June 27th, 2009There are three ways to install a sims3pack.
- You put it in the downloads folder then open launcher go to the downloads tab and check the checkbox by the file and click install.
- You just click on the sims3pack in it’s current location the launcher opens the installer process and installs it that way.
- You use a 3rd party program like Josh’s 3Viewer that extracts the package file from the Sims3pack file then installs it.
I prefer method 3 which will install all but Object Presets. Those still have to be installed via method 1 or 2.
For package files that are already extracted. You must have the framework installed to use them unless they are sims or lots.
They go in your Mod/Package folder if they are anything but Sims or Lots. Sims go in your SavedSims folder and Lots go in your Library Folder.
For Presets, Patterns, Objects, Clothes and Hair installed via the launcher they can be found in your DCCache folder in the following files dcdb0.dbc or dcdb0.ebc or dcdb1.dbc. Sims and Lots are always installed into SavedSims and Library Folders even if you use Method 3 to install them.
Files installed using Method 3 that are put in Mod/Package folder will NOT show up in the launcher Installed Content but will show up in game without having a * by it. Just like in Sims 2 if you put a file in your bin folder.
Using Method 3 –3Viewer
1. Installing a Single Sims3pack
Open 3Viewer then you will get a first start wizard.
In Save Game Location find your Documents game folder’s path and put it in that box
Like mine is
C:\Users\username\Documents\Electronic Arts\The Sims 3
In Game Data Location (This is the path where you have your game installed)
Put the path of your game installation folder.
I have Copy Sims3packs to download after install uncheck. (No need to clutter up that folder)
Click Next it will ask you if you want to install resource.cfg make sure to tell it NO.
Now it’s setup for use.
This program is for Sims3packs not package files! Use Monkey Installer for them instead.
To install one sims3pack using 3Viewer
Click File\Open and navigate to a sims3pack file. I’m gonna open a sims3pack containing a saved sim

The image slider will show you all the pics inside the sims3pack.
I am hoping later Josh adds a way to extract them but for now you can just view them.
Now if it’s a pattern or CAS preset you’re installing by default 3Viewer will put it in your Mods/Package folder.
You can tell it to prompt you each time you install a sims3pack for a save location by going to Help/View Options
and check Always Prompt Me to Choose Installation Location.
Now we want to go to the Packed Files tab so we can install the sim.
Now you see the file listing on the left side.
You want to select the file with the package extension. I.E. *.package
Once selected go to box labeled Name box and type in the name from the Display name box or anything name you want.
Note: You can use basic copy & paste key shortcuts to copy the filename from the Display Name.
You can also skip this step if you don’t wish to rename the file at all.
Once you type in the package file’s new name click Rename.
You will now see the new renamed package file in the file listing with the name you just given it.
Now all you do is click the round Install button.
Now if you have in options set to prompt you each time for a new save location a small box will pop up.
If not you’re done and can skip the next steps.
If it’s Sims or Lots you’re installing you would just click Install and then you’re done!
For other files such as Patterns or Presets,
On the small box popup make sure both boxes labeled:
Place a Copy in DCBackup & Copy sims3pack to Downloads is unchecked!
Uncheck Standard Installation and then go to Installation Destination
click the dropdown box and choose Custom. The program will then ask you where
to save the package file.
Navigate to the folder you want to save to then click Install.
That’s it now you’re really done!
2. Installing Multiple Sims3packs.
The Batch Install process is sooo much easier!
Open 3Viewer then go to File/Batch Install a small window will pop up.
Check the first two boxes and click okay.
Now navigate to the folder full of sims3packs files you want to install.
Click Open and then wait till it’s finish the click Done.
That’s all there is too it!
All files will be name to whatever their sims3pack filename is.
It will add a counter number to the filename so it doesn’t overwrite anything.
If you have Patterns or CAS Presets it puts in them in the Mods/Package folder by default.
You then can organize them into whatever folders you like by doing it yourself or using Monkey Installer.
This works for Sims, Lots, Patterns and CAS Presets.
It does not work for Object Presets those muse be install with the Launcher.
